Abstract

The invention mainly relates to a thread-residue-free weaving process of a flat weaving machine. During normal weaving, a needle selection cylinder is located at a position A, a first needle selectionrod participates in needle selection, a machine head normally weaves by using first yarns, when second yarns are used, a needle selection drum turns to a position B, a second needle selection rod participates in needle selection, and the machine head uses the second yarns to perform one-time tucking weaving; and then the needle selection drum turns to the position A, and the first needle selecting rod participates in needle selection. After the machine head normally weaves one circle by using the first yarns, the needle selecting drum rotates to the position B again, the second needle selection rod participates in needle selection, and the machine head uses the first yarns to perform tucking weaving again; and finally, the needle selecting drum returns to the position A, the first needleselection rod participates in needle selection, and the machine head carries out normal weaving by using the second yarns to finish the thread-residue-free weaving process. According to the process, when a multi-color product is woven and threads are changed, no thread residues are generated, and manual thread residue closing is not needed, so that the product quality and the working efficiency are improved, and the economic benefit of enterprises is further improved.

technical field [0001] The invention relates to a knitting process, in particular to a knitting process of a flat knitting machine without ends. Background technique [0002] The flat knitting machine is used for knitting gloves, socks and other items. Traditional multi-color product knitting requires manual finishing of thread ends when changing threads to avoid leaking threads and holes. However, due to the time-consuming and labor-intensive use of traditional manual methods, The work efficiency is not high, and omissions are prone to occur, and the current labor cost has also increased significantly, which affects the economic benefits of the enterprise.
